Puntuación:
El libro está bien considerado por su claridad y practicidad en la enseñanza de la concurrencia y la programación asíncrona en C#. Explica con eficacia conceptos relacionados con Task y async/await de C#, lo que lo convierte en un recurso valioso tanto para principiantes como para desarrolladores experimentados. Sin embargo, algunos lectores opinan que la profundidad del contenido no justifica el precio, y hay quejas sobre el estado en que llegó el libro.
Ventajas:Separación de capítulos clara y coherente, excelente para entender la programación asíncrona en C#, ejemplos concisos y prácticos, bueno tanto para desarrolladores principiantes como experimentados, enfoque práctico y moderno, referencia útil para multithreading.
Desventajas:Algunos contenidos pueden parecer demasiado básicos para el precio, no hay suficiente profundidad en los ejemplos, se presuponen conocimientos previos del tema, el estado de entrega del libro era malo, y algunos lectores expresaron que se lee más como una recopilación de blogs que como un libro de texto completo.
(basado en 16 opiniones de lectores)
Concurrency in C# Cookbook: Asynchronous, Parallel, and Multithreaded Programming
Si usted es uno de los muchos desarrolladores que aún no está seguro sobre el desarrollo concurrente y multihilo, este práctico libro de recetas le hará cambiar de opinión. Con más de 85 recetas ricas en código en esta segunda edición actualizada, el autor Stephen Cleary demuestra técnicas de procesamiento paralelo y programación asíncrona utilizando bibliotecas y características del lenguaje .NET y C# 8.0. 0.
La concurrencia es ahora más común en el desarrollo de aplicaciones escalables y con capacidad de respuesta, pero sigue siendo extremadamente difícil de codificar. Las soluciones detalladas de este libro de cocina muestran cómo las herramientas modernas elevan el nivel de abstracción, haciendo que la concurrencia sea mucho más fácil que antes. Completas con código listo para usar y discusiones sobre cómo y por qué funcionan las soluciones, estas recetas le ayudarán a:
⬤ Ponerse al día sobre la concurrencia y la programación asíncrona y paralela.
⬤ Utilizar async y await para operaciones asíncronas.
⬤ Mejorar su código con flujos asíncronos.
⬤ Explorar la programación paralela con la Biblioteca Paralela de Tareas de .NET.
⬤ Crear pipelines de flujo de datos con la librería TPL Dataflow de.NET.
⬤ Comprender las capacidades que System. Reactive construye sobre LINQ.
⬤ Utilizar colecciones inmutables y threadsafe.
⬤ Aprender a realizar pruebas unitarias con código concurrente.
⬤ Hacer que el grupo de hilos trabaje para usted.
⬤ Habilitar la cancelación limpia y cooperativa.
⬤ Examinar escenarios para combinar enfoques concurrentes.
⬤ Sumergirse en la programación asíncrona orientada a objetos.
⬤ Reconocer y escribir adaptadores para código que utilice estilos asíncronos antiguos.
© Book1 Group - todos los derechos reservados.
El contenido de este sitio no se puede copiar o usar, ni en parte ni en su totalidad, sin el permiso escrito del propietario.
Última modificación: 2024.11.14 07:32 (GMT)